adding subdomain to sharepoint site.

Here is what I have going on. My server is spfe-03. You go to spfe-03 and my project site loads just like it should. You go to spfe-03:12345 and mysites load. Just like It should 

Now I had our DNS guy create a new entry called SharePoint and I added sharepoint as a default zone under AAM and it worked. Now what I would like is my.sharepoint to point to mysites. I created a default zone under AAM for the mysites collection but it doesn't translate. I don't think we need any new records under DNS so I am unsure where to go from here. Your mysties are running @ spfe-03:12345. It is not running in port 80.  Please create a host header in IIS (which is same as the DNS entry), change the port number of the sites from 12345 to 80. Then add AAM.
